Rhododendron ponticum · Shrub
Bud blight (Pestalotiopsis): Prune out affected growth in dry weather and avoid overhead watering to reduce humidity.
Powdery mildew: Improve air circulation by thinning dense thickets and apply a suitable fungicide if severe.
Root rot (Phytophthora): Ensure well-drained soil conditions and avoid waterlogging; remove severely infected plants.
Slugs and snails: Use physical barriers like copper tape or apply iron phosphate-based slug pellets.
Budworm (Coleophora rhododendrella): Monitor for webbing in late spring and prune out infested buds before larvae emerge.
